Optimize ReplaceLineEndings - #81630

  • If we haven't replaced anything, avoid allocating the new string
    • Loop in IndexOfNewlineChar until something other than the replacementText is found
  • If we're replacing new lines with a line feed ('\n' - default on non-Windows), we can avoid searching for the line feed, thus avoiding breaking out of the vectorized path unnecessarily
    • If we're searching for 5 values instead of 6, we also switch from the probabilistic map to SpanHelpers.IndexOfAnyValueType

Out of curiosity, I wonder what the performance profile would look like for instead doing the equivalent of a Count("\r\n"), then allocating a string of exactly the right length (string.Length - count), and then formatting directly into that string, rather than going into a growable VSB and then copying into a new string at the end.

Given this is effectively a glorified string.Replace, we could use a similar approach of building the list of indices.
I'll try it out.

Tested with MihaZupan@b68c952 and it's similar or a bit worse across the board.
